Hamas Frees Two Israeli Female Hostages

Gaza: After freeing two American hostages, Hamas rebels on Monday freed two more Israeli citizens.

Nurit Cooper (85) and Yocheved Lifshitz (79) are the freed Israeli women, the Israeli Prime Minister’s Office said.

The woman’s family lives in the Nir Oz Kibbutz area of Israel and was taken hostage during the October 7 attack. Both husbands have not been released by the rebels, The Times of Israel reported.

The hostages have been handed over to the International Committee of the Red Cross (ICRC) and are now on their way home, the ICRC said in a statement.

Hamas rebels have taken more than 200 hostages during the attack on Israel.
